Augustus Emory Adamson II was born to Linton Mallory Adamson and Geneva Power Adamson in Clayton County, Georgia. He was the eldest of nine children. He was named after his father's twin brother. His siblings were: Annie Ellen Adamson James 1907-1977; Margie Allene Adamson Petty 1909-1996; Linton Lamar Adamson 1911-1992; Nellie Fay Adamson Dalick 1915-1952; Mary Wynette Adamson Ragsdale 1916-2007; Bertyce Carole Adamson Bryan 1918-2001; Ray Power Adamson 1920-1992; Linton Mallory Adamson 1922-1969. He came from a large and influential family descended from the Maryland Adamson family. He was a United States Postal Inspector and when he lived in West Plains, Missouri,he met and married Susan Bernice Beasley Adamson on June 16, 1938. In July, 1940, they increased their family with twin daughters - Janice Adamson and Janet Adamson Haynie who died on August 27, 1971, leaving a husband and a 15-month old daughter, Susan Mallory Haynie. In August of 1943, another daughter was added to the Adamson family, Julia A. Adamson. Augustus Emory Adamson II was a true Southern gentleman and when he met our mother, we are told that he thought she was a most beautiful woman,and as a true gentleman he asked one of his friends to introduce her to him. Their honeymoon was spent in Europe. He loved his family and friends, and we miss and love him very much.
